Ustyurt Plateau
The Ustyurt Plateau is another mysterious place in Kazakhstan, it is located between the northern part of the Caspian Sea and the Aral Sea. On almost all sides it is bordered by steep cliffs - cliffs, composed of sedimentary rocks under which lie clay, limestone, sandstone, and gypsum. The plateau was formed as a result of natural disasters on the earth and is a plateau with a number of elevations in the form of gentle ramparts and basins. Ancient cemeteries and ancient monuments are scattered throughout the plateau, and from a bird's eye view you can see strange arrow-shaped signs or structures. Many claim to have seen a UFO here.
